Wahoo's is a fast-casual eatery that serves California Mexican cuisine. The restaurant offers a variety of dishes, including fish quesadillas, breakfast burritos, and fish tacos. The portions are generous, with large servings that can be hard to finish in one sitting. The food is flavorful, with highlights including the green sauce on the breakfast burritos. However, some dishes may be dry or slightly mushy, depending on the meal and location. The atmosphere is clean and uncluttered, with plenty of natural lighting and casual seating, making it a comfortable place to dine. The service is friendly and straightforward, providing quick service that is convenient for travelers. Prices are slightly elevated, but the value is good considering the quality of the food and service. Wahoo's remains a good option for a quick and satisfying meal, whether for breakfast, lunch, or dinner.
